> Hello all, > > I'd like to start a discussion (but hopefully a brief one!) about using > property testing techniques in Twisted. > The discussion seems to have petered out. :) On the basis of at least a luke-warm reception to this idea, I've gone ahead and merged a branch that adds a Hypothesis dependency to the Trial test suite. Hypothesis is used to test some code that itself supports the testing of Trial itself - so this is very internal to Twisted if we need to replace the tests with "normal" tests then I don't see how there could be any impact on any public Twisted APIs. I also filed https://github.com/twisted/twisted/issues/11649 for the follow-up work to configure Hypothesis on CI to avoid non-deterministic failures in case there are any bugs in the code being tested by Hypothesis (or in those tests themselves).
